In the deep waters of the ocean, coral reefs are found in abundance. Algae live within these coral reefs, producing pigments that give corals their color and providing nutrients that corals need to survive. In return, corals offer shelter to the algae. So, coral and algae share a association. Climate change has led to increasing ocean temperatures, which can cause corals to expel the algae living inside of them.
